The 1951 unsolved killing of Harry and Harriette Moore

Seventy-one years ago, a bomb exploded at the home of civil rights activists Harry T. and Harriette V. Moore on Christmas night. Moore died at a local hospital an hour later, while his wife succumbed to her injuries nine days following the explosion. The killing was clearly racially motivated, and authorities never arrested anyone for the heinous act.
